NBVI raises funds for 4 year-old cancer victim

ROAD TOWN, Tortola, VI - The National Bank of the Virgin Islands (NBVI), in a collaborative effort which included the pooling of sums donated by the NBVI, together with personal donations from members of staff, successfully raised $1,570 to support the efforts of Ms Jasmine Watson, in her attempt to raise funds for her grandson, Jahdiel Watson.

SSB now 33% shareholder in NBVI; Makes $15M investment

ROAD TOWN, Tortola, VI- The Social Security Board (SSB) of the Virgin Islands has made an investment of $15M of taxpayers money into the National Bank of the Virgin Islands (NBVI), making it a 33% shareholder in the local bank.
